Step into Virtual Reality with the Star Wars: Secrets of the Empire Experience
New to Downtown Disney, The VOID uses hyper-reality technology to immerse guests in the Star Wars universe, sending groups of four undercover as Stormtroopers to ensure the rebellion’s survival.

Get in Touch with Nature
The bridge across Disneyland Drive in Downtown Disney offers a great photo opp in front of the arboretum that features a drought-resistant garden. Throughout the district, specialty planters are also decked out with seasonal treatments such as pumpkins, holiday ornaments and more.

Satisfy a Sweet Craving with Handmade Treats
Peer through the window of Marceline’s Confectionary to watch the famous candy apples sold in Disneyland Park being made, or pick up a batch of artisanal macarons and cake pops from Orange County’s own Kayla’s Cakes.

Groove to the Beat of Nightly Entertainment
Musicians ranging from acapella artists to dueling DJs create a live soundtrack for visitors to the Downtown Disney District. The full entertainment schedule is on disneyland.com.
